Harlan D. Pratt, age 80, of West Fargo, ND died peacefully surrounded by family at Sanford Medical Center July 24th, 2019.
Harlan was born in Cooperstown and raised on the family farm before enlisting in the U.S. Air Force. This is where he was introduced to computers and was on the ground floor of this new technology. This became his occupation throughout his working career. He considered himself as one of the first computer nerds, but still maintained a corny sense of humor.
He met Carol Saele in Valley City while she was in nursing school. They were later married in Munich. Together they raised 2 children, Robert and Maria. Their marriage ended in divorce.
In March of 1984 Harlan met Kathleen Schwartz and they were married in June of that same year.
Together they traveled, went camping, and did a lot of fishing. The Eastern Star and Masonic Lodge were also a large part of their marriage, where they made lots of friends along the way.
Harlan served as the past Grand Patron of Eastern Star. He also served as the Past Grand Organist and the Past Master of East Gate Lodge.
Harlan is survived by his wife of 35 years, Kathy, son, Robert Pratt; daughter, Maria (Mike) Rohde; two step children, Beth and Lewis Schwartz; sister, Roberta (Martin) Kloster; three grandchildren and two great grandchildren.
